How The Blood Bag Changed The Face Of Hospital Management

The blood bag may sound like a fairly basic piece of thing, but the development of this was a turning point in our medical ground.

Without the advantage of a blood transfusion there are many operations which could not be performed and would never have been tried. We take the idea of a blood transfusion for granted. But precisely, a blood transfusion is a quite recent development.

At first there was no means to store blood, so a transfusion had to be absolutely from one vein into a second vein. This was obviously very restricting. Blood could not be preserved until a suitable anticoagulant was discovered. Richard Lewison invented this in 1915; sodium citrate.

Within just a couple of years blood was being donated and stored for few days at a time. This provided many of those injured during the last years of the 1st World War a possibility to thrive.

The blood was being donated and stored in glass containers. It was already discovered that blood could be divided into its component parts of blood plasma and RBCs; but this was very unsafe due to the possibility of contamination during the procedure.

Nonetheless, with the growth by Fenwal Company of the plastic blood bag in 1953 everything changed. This was a great way to store and transfer blood with minimal contamination risk; quickly so much more was possible.

The first blood banks were launched in the Soviet Union, United States and Europe during the late 1930s. Although it would need many years to upgrade the glass storage jars, in all areas, the process was established and immediately there were increasingly more uses of blood transfusions and more daring surgeries were happening with this extra support.

So now the blood could be obtained, divided, and preserved; but transport still needed to be discovered. Blood needs to be stored at the appropriate temperature and a constant temperature. Just as the mobile phone has gone from the volume and weight of brick to something not much larger than a credit card; so the transport of blood has progressed.There are now thermal blood carrying bags which allow medics to take blood to where ever it is necessary. These are important for the quick and efficient treatment we have all come to expect.

So the small blood bag has revolutionised our planet, and yet many people will never know the names of the people who are contributing for saving lives every minuet of every day.
